Market Context
Trading volume for ADUS has exhibited typical patterns consistent with the stock's average daily activity levels, suggesting no unusual institutional movements at present. The home healthcare services industry has experienced notable shifts in recent periods, driven by evolving reimbursement landscapes and changing patient preferences that favor home-based treatment over institutional care settings. The sector has benefited from demographic tailwinds, as an aging population increasingly requires personal care services that can be delivered in residential environments. Healthcare services stocks have shown mixed performance across the broader market, with investors carefully evaluating margins, labor costs, and regulatory developments that could impact profitability. For ADUS specifically, the personal care segment represents a substantial portion of revenue, making the company's payor mix and state-level Medicaid program dynamics particularly relevant to understanding business fundamentals. Industry observers note that the shift toward value-based care models may create both opportunities and challenges for home care providers, depending on how reimbursement structures evolve in coming periods.

Technical Analysis
From a technical perspective, Addus HomeCare Corporation (ADUS) is trading with immediate support identified at the $92.43 level, representing a significant floor that has attracted buying interest during recent pullbacks. This support zone carries importance as it represents a price point where buyers have historically emerged to absorb selling pressure, creating potential stabilization in adverse conditions. Conversely, resistance stands at $102.15, marking an overhead supply level that has capped upside attempts during recent trading sessions. The current price of $97.29 positions the stock roughly midway between these technical boundaries, suggesting the market is in a consolidation phase awaiting additional catalysts for directional conviction.
The Relative Strength Index, while not at extreme readings, indicates momentum that remains balanced between overbought and oversold territory, consistent with the rangebound price action observed in recent weeks. Moving averages are tracking in a manner that reflects the sideways price movement, with shorter-term averages neither diverging dramatically above nor below longer-term counterparts. This technical configuration often suggests a market in a decision-making phase, where subsequent price movement could be more pronounced once a breakout occurs. Volume patterns during this consolidation phase have been relatively subdued, indicating investor hesitation rather than aggressive positioning in either direction. The 0.67% single-session gain, while modest, demonstrates that buying interest persists near current levels, preventing further slippage toward the support zone.

Outlook
For ADUS shares, the near-term technical outlook centers on the stock's ability to establish directionality from its current consolidation range. A sustained move above the $102.15 resistance level could signal renewed bullish momentum, potentially targeting higher prices as technical sellers cover positions and new buyers enter. Such a breakout scenario would likely require supportive fundamental catalysts, which could emerge from positive developments in reimbursement rates or successful execution of growth initiatives within the company's service footprint.
Alternatively, should selling pressure intensify, the $92.43 support level becomes the critical technical reference point to monitor. A breach of this support would represent a more bearish development, possibly attracting additional technical selling and establishing a new trading range for the security. Investors observing ADUS may wish to pay close attention to volume dynamics accompanying any future price movements, as a breakout accompanied by elevated volume would lend greater credence to the move's sustainability.
The balance of risks and opportunities for Addus HomeCare Corporation remains tied to sector fundamentals, regulatory developments affecting Medicaid reimbursement, and broader healthcare spending trends. The stock's current technical positioning offers a relatively defined risk-reward framework, with clear reference points for both bullish and bearish scenarios. As always, broader market conditions and company-specific developments will ultimately determine whether technical levels hold or give way to new price discovery.
